Tamme
Tamme is a village in Võru Parish, Võru County in southeastern Estonia. Tamme has about 14 residents.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Härmä is a village in Setomaa Parish, Võru County in southeastern Estonia. As of the 2011 census, the settlement's population was 6. Härmä Chapel, a small wooden Seto chapel, is located in the village. Härmä is situated 4 km south of Tamme.

Orava is a village in Võru Parish, Võru County, South East Estonia. Orava railway station on Tartu-Pechory railway line is located around 3 km north of the village. It is second station on the Edelaraudtee Koidula - Tartu route. Orava is situated 8 km northeast of Tamme.
